Translation(s): English - Italiano


Modem software Smart Link

Questa pagina descrive come abilitare il supporto per i modem software PCI e USB Smart Link nei sistemi Debian.

slmodem è un driver per i modem software e supporta:

I dispositivi supportati sono elencati al fondo di questa pagina, il driver consiste di due componenti:

  1. slmodemd - demone dell'applicazione

  2. driver del kernel Linux specifici per il tipo di hardware, ovvero:
    • snd-atiixp-modem (ATI IXP 150/200/250, ALSA)

    • snd-intel8x0m (AMD-768 / Intel ICH / NVidia MCP/2/2S/3 / SiS 7013, ALSA)

    • snd-via82xx-modem (VIA VT82xx, ALSA)

    • slamr (SmartPCI56, proprietario)

    • slusb (SmartUSB56, proprietario)

{i} sl-modem-daemon è in "non-free" a causa dell'inclusione di un componente solo binario (dsplibs.o) dentro slmodemd.

<!> Questo programma è disponibile solo per le architetture i386 e AMD64; mentre i moduli del kernel Linux proprietari solo per i386.

Installazione

  1. Aggiungere la sezione "non-free" al file /etc/apt/sources.list per la propria versione di Debian, ad esempio:

    # Debian Squeeze/6.0
    deb http://ftp.us.debian.org/debian squeeze main contrib non-free

    o

    # Debian Wheezy (testing)
    deb http://ftp.us.debian.org/debian wheezy main contrib non-free
  2. Aggiornare l'elenco dei pacchetti disponibili e installare il pacchetto sl-modem-daemon:

    aptitude update && aptitude install sl-modem-daemon
  3. Selezionare l'ubicazione del paese del modem quando richiesto, questa impostazione viene salvata nel file /etc/default/sl-modem-daemon.

  4. Il demone di slmodem verrà avviato dopo l'installazione, se si possiede un dispositivo supportato dal modulo snd-atiixp-modem, snd-intel8x0m o snd-via82xx-modem non è richiesto nient'altro, saltare alla sezione utilizzo più in basso.

Dispositivi SmartPCI56 e SmartUSB56

Per gestire il dispositivo bisogna compilare e installare i driver proprietari per il kernel Linux; essi sono disponibili solo per l'architettura i386.

Squeeze

  1. Installare gli appropriati pacchetti linux-headers e sl-modem-source:

    aptitude -r install linux-headers-2.6-$(uname -r|sed 's,[^-]*-[^-]*-,,') sl-modem-source

    Questo installa anche il pacchetto dkms raccomandato. DKMS compilerà i moduli slmodem per il sistema. Il modulo appropriato sarà caricato automaticamente.

  2. Avviare il demone slmodem:

    invoke-rc.d sl-modem-daemon start

Wheezy

  1. Installare gli appropriati pacchetti linux-headers e sl-modem-source:

     aptitude install linux-headers-$(uname -r|sed 's,[^-]*-[^-]*-,,') sl-modem-source
    DKMS compilerà i moduli slmodem per il sistema. Il modulo appropriato sarà caricato automaticamente.
  2. Avviare il demone slmodem:

invoke-rc.d sl-modem-daemon start

Utilizzo

Il modem dovrebbe ora essere accessibile tramite il device a caratteri /dev/ttySL0. Per configurarlo in modo appropriato si faccia riferimento alla documentazione del programma di connessione PPP.

Problemi noti

Vedere le segnalazioni dei bug per sl-modem.

Dispositivi supportati

snd-atiixp-modem

Questa pagina spiega come identificare un dispositivo PCI.

Il seguente elenco si basa sui campi alias di modinfo snd-atiixp-modem nelle immagini del kernel Debian 2.6.32 (2.6.32-41):

snd-intel8x0m

Questa pagina spiega come identificare un dispositivo PCI.

Il seguente elenco si basa sui campi alias di modinfo snd-intel8x0m nelle immagini del kernel Debian 2.6.32 (2.6.32-41):

snd-via82xx-modem

Questa pagina spiega come identificare un dispositivo PCI.

Il seguente elenco si basa sui campi alias di modinfo snd-via82xx-modem nelle immagini del kernel Debian 2.6.32 (2.6.32-41):

slamr

Questa pagina spiega come identificare un dispositivo PCI.

Il seguente elenco si basa sui campi alias di modinfo slamr compilato da lenny/sl-modem-source:

slusb

Questa pagina spiega come identificare un dispositivo PCI.

Il seguente elenco si basa sui campi alias di modinfo slusb compilato da lenny/sl-modem-source:

Si veda anche

Collegamenti esterni


CategoryHardware